Louis van Gaal has told Manchester United he needs to sign FOUR more
players this summer to turn the club into title challengers again.
The United boss, who has already splashed out more than £150million
on new signings since taking over at Old Trafford, has identified the
key targets he reckons the club need to sign this summer.
According to the Mirror, Van Gaal has handed executive vice-chairman
Ed Woodward a list that includes Roma midfielder Kevin Strootman,
Wolfsburg winger Kevin de Bruyne and Borussia Dortmund duo Mats Hummels
and Ilkay Gundogan.
Van Gaal has come under fire in recent weeks as United have dropped
off the pace in the race for Champions League places, with summer
signings Angel di Maria and Radamel Falcao both being linked with moves
away from the club.
But defiant Van Gaal still believes he is the man to turn things
around and reckons the 20-time English champions have a bright future.
